Transaction 66dbe32cbd1428f50b29afe20cb42754bb2394588ac36fb0a7eb84deb3c36f95
1 Input
1 Output
-
66dbe32cbd1428f50b29afe20cb42754bb2394588ac36fb0a7eb84deb3c36f95:0
- value
- 165829
- script pubkey
- OP_0 OP_PUSHBYTES_20 c4cd81fb64fcb171aee84d4a5f1776a782bc9fd3
- address
- bc1qcnxcr7myljchrthgf49979mk57pte87nuflzmt